Ouachita Parish has four courts having criminal jurisdictions, the 4th Judicial District Court, Monroe City Court, West Monroe City Court, and Sterlington City Court. All felonies are in the 4th Judicial District Court. Misdemeanors and traffic cases may be in any of the four courts. There are five sections of the 4th JDC with felony criminal jurisdiction, one section with misdemeanor criminal jurisdiction, and one Drug Court.
